Krypton is named after the Greek word that means “secret.” Which explains why krypton was most likely given this name?
bekas [8.4K]

Answer:

Krypton is a noble gas, so it was difficult for chemists to find it, as though it was a secret.

Explanation:

Krypton (₃₆Kr), an element with atomic number 36, belongs to group 18 on the periodic table of elements. This group is a specific one - it's made up of elements known as noble gases. Besides krypton, these elements are: helium, neon, argon, xenon, and radon. All noble gases were characterized relatively late compared to other elements. They all conduct electricity, fluoresce, and are odorless and colorless. Besides that, they have very low chemical reactivity. Because of their stability, they are often used to maintain a safe, constant environment. As krypton shares all of these characteristics, it was difficult for chemists to find it. That's why it was most likely given that name.
